Understanding Football OTAs: Schedule, Purpose, and Importance

Football franchises' Organized Practice Activities, or OTAs, are a vital part of the preseason preparation process . Typically spanning over three weeks in May and June, OTAs provide players the chance to work on plays, develop chemistry, and become familiar to the new offensive and defensive strategies. While controlled contact is featured, OTAs are largely focused on drills and introducing the approach . They’re much less intense than get more info training preseason camp but are exceedingly important for determining player readiness and ensuring the organization is ready for the next season. Essentially, OTAs are a foundation toward peak performance.
